Rules - 7 Card Stud Rules
In
7 Card Stud two down cards and one face up card dealt
to each player. Once each player has their cards there
is an initial round of betting. Once the first round
of betting is concluded each player is dealt one card
face up and another round of betting occurs. This is
repeated two more times for a total of four face up
cards each with a round of betting. A final card is
dealt face down followed by the last round of betting.
During fixed limit games the first two rounds of
betting are for the lower limit amount. All additional
betting rounds are for the higher limit amount.
The
player who assembles the best 5 card hand wins the
pot. In the event two or more players assemble the
same valued hand the pot is divided equally amongst
the winners.
7
Card Stud Game Play Review
1.
Players must place an ante into the pot to start the
round.
2.
Each player is dealt two down cards and one face up
card.
3.
1st round of betting.
4.
One face up card is dealt.
5.
2nd round of betting.
6.
Another face up card is dealt.
7.
3rd round of betting.
8.
Third face up card is dealt.
9.
4th round of betting.
10.
The last (river) card is dealt face down.
11.
Last round of betting.
Remaining
players have a showdown and must make their best 5
card poker hand from any of their 7 cards.
General
7 Card Stud Rules
1.
The first betting round is initiated by the player
with the lowest ranking up card.
Since this is a forced bet, the player must
open for the minimum and cannot fold at this time.
2.
If your first or second hole card is accidentally
flipped up by the dealer it will become your face up
card and the third card will be dealt face down to
replace it.
3.
If you are not present to act when it is your forced
bet or ante, your hand will be taken and your bet or
ante will be forfeited.
4.
In the instance that more than 7 cards are dealt to a
player, that hand is deemed dead.
5.
The dealer must announce the low card before the first
round of betting.
